## **Why Is Trump Considering Deportation?**
Under **Temporary Protected Status (TPS)** and other humanitarian relief programs, thousands of Ukrainians fleeing the war have found refuge in the United States. However, reports indicate that Trump, if re-elected, may **end these protections**, forcing thousands of Ukrainian nationals to return to their war-torn homeland.
### **Possible Reasons Behind This Decision:**
1. **Tougher Immigration Policies:** Trump has consistently advocated for stricter immigration laws and may see this as a continuation of his agenda.
2. **Reevaluating Foreign Aid & Support:** With growing political debate over U.S. aid to Ukraine, some believe this move could signal a **shift in U.S. priorities**.
3. **Domestic Political Strategy:** Trump might be using this as a way to appeal to his base, which largely supports **stronger border control and limited immigration**.
## **What Would This Mean for Ukrainians in the U.S.?**
If implemented, this policy could create **massive disruptions** for the Ukrainian community in the U.S. Many of these individuals have built lives in America, contributing to the economy and integrating into society.
### **Potential Consequences:**
– **Families Torn Apart** โ Many Ukrainians in the U.S. have established families, jobs, and homes. Deportation could force them to separate from loved ones.
– **Sending People Back to a War Zone** โ Ukraine remains a dangerous place due to the ongoing war with Russia. Deporting Ukrainians could place them directly in harmโs way.
– **Impact on the U.S. Workforce** โ Many Ukrainian immigrants work in industries struggling with labor shortages. Removing them could hurt local economies.
